What Makes International Casinos Different?
These sites hold licences from jurisdictions like Curaçao, Malta, or Gibraltar – not the UK Gambling Commission. That means no requirement to enrol in GamStop, and no limit on how much you can stake on a slot or roulette spin. The trade-off? Less state-mandated consumer protection. You trade the safety net for faster withdrawals and better welcome offers. It’s a straightforward bargain if you know what to look for.

The Payment Landscape
Where non GamStop casinos differ most is in speed and variety. Cryptocurrency is a common weapon –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in – because it bypasses the slow cross-border processing chain. But traditional methods still dominate. Here’s the trade-off in a glance:
| Payment Type | Typical Speed |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| Debit/Credit Cards | 1-5 business days | Familiarity, no extra sign-ups |
| Digital Wallets (Skrill, Neteller) | Instant – 24 hours | Fast deposits and withdrawals |
| Cryptocurrencies | 10-60 minutes | Privacy, low fees, quick cashouts |
| Bank Transfer | 3-7 business days | Large sums, though slow |
If speed matters, crypto or e-wallets win every time. Cards are fine, but expect a lag.
